About the department: Equipped with specialized technologies, including Balance Master, VitalStim, and Anodyne, the Rehab Services Department works closely with physicians to provide acute and outpatient physical, occupational, and speech therapy services to restore the functional abilities of patients. Emphasis is placed on collaboration and teamwork, and new therapists are encouraged to grow their skills through professional development and mentorship. The department routinely finishes within the 90th percentile or better in the nation for patient satisfaction. A typical day includes: Ass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ating speech language therapy treatments for patients by utilizing equipment, supplies, and procedures appropriate to achieve intended outcomes.- Identifies patients appropriate for rehabilitative therapies
- Establishes an effective plan of care using appropriate skills for evaluation and screening
- Develops and implement treatment plans that lead to optimal patient outcomes
- Communicates effectively with patients, care team members, physicians, and others
- Writes clear, concise, legible documentation that includes appropriate information for care planning
- Education: Graduation from an accredited college or university with a Master's Degree in Speech Language Pathology
- Experience: New graduates welcome, 1 year of experience preferred
- Skills: Problem-solving, planning and time-management, verbal and non-verbal communication, basic computer skills, ability to work independently, and listening skills
- Licensure/Certification: Licensed by the Missouri Board of Registration for the Healing Arts; Current State of Missouri Speech Language Pathologist License
- Physical: Physical stamina to sit for extended periods, walk and move around frequently, and lift up to 20 lbs.
